Research Interests

Biomedical Signal Processing & Modeling

Computational methods for interpreting physiological signals and modeling biomedical systems.

Body-Worn Sensor Algorithms

Algorithms for wearable sensors, including accelerometer, gyroscope, pressure sensor, and ECG monitoring data.

Affective Computing from Biosignals

Emotion and stress assessment using physiological signals such as heart rate and heart rate variability.

Outcome Evaluation

Objective evaluation of gait, balance, physical activity, and physiological response in real-world and clinical contexts.

Clinical Decision Support

Predictive models and clinical decision support systems that translate data into actionable healthcare insight.
